Gross enrolment ratio, primary, adjusted gender parity index in ESCAP: Wb Low Income Economies (wb_low) (unsdcode:98439)
ESCAP: Wb Low Income Economies (wb_low) (unsdcode:98439): Gross enrolment ratio, primary, adjusted gender parity index was 0.9417 GPIA in 2024. ▲ Rising
Gross enrolment ratio, primary, adjusted gender parity index in ESCAP: Wb Low Income Economies (wb_low) (unsdcode:98439), 1970–2024
Source: UNESCO Institute for Statistics. Measured in GPIA.
Analysis
The most recent figure for gross enrolment ratio, primary, adjusted gender parity index in ESCAP: Wb Low Income Economies (wb_low) (unsdcode:98439) is 0.9417 GPIA, measured in 2024. That is the highest value across all 55 years on record.
The figure is up 0.1% on the previous year and up 3.1% over ten years.
Over the whole period, gross enrolment ratio, primary, adjusted gender parity index in ESCAP: Wb Low Income Economies (wb_low) (unsdcode:98439) peaked at 0.9417 GPIA in 2024 and was at its lowest, 0.6437 GPIA, in 1971.
ESCAP: Wb Low Income Economies (wb_low) (unsdcode:98439) ranks 206th of 221 groups on this measure, in the bottom quarter.
The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 55 years of available data.

Averages by decade
| Decade | Average | Lowest | Highest | Years |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1970s | 0.6693 GPIA | 0.6437 GPIA | 0.6933 GPIA | 10 |
| 1980s | 0.7366 GPIA | 0.7021 GPIA | 0.7615 GPIA | 10 |
| 1990s | 0.7639 GPIA | 0.7494 GPIA | 0.7816 GPIA | 10 |
| 2000s | 0.8368 GPIA | 0.7929 GPIA | 0.8909 GPIA | 10 |
| 2010s | 0.9148 GPIA | 0.8976 GPIA | 0.9256 GPIA | 10 |
| 2020s | 0.9366 GPIA | 0.9289 GPIA | 0.9417 GPIA | 5 |
